The Arbitration Agreement outlines the process for resolving disputes between purchasers of manufactured homes and retailers through binding arbitration, as defined in the context of business in Middlesex. It emphasizes the binding nature of the agreement and notes that it is part of the sales contract for the home. Key features include the requirement for written notice of arbitration intentions and the specification of the arbitration process through the American Arbitration Association. The form details the thresholds for the type of arbitration panel based on the claim amount, providing clarity on how disputes will be handled. Filling instructions encourage the parties to complete and sign the agreement at the time of executing the sales contract.
